The 27-year-old wing-back joined Inter Milan in the summer of 2021 from Dutch outfit PSV.

 

And last season Dumfries displayed excellent performances to help Nerazzurri to win the Copa Italiana and finished as runners-up in the Champions League.

 

 

The player has drawn attention from several Premier League clubs this summer, including Everton who want a full-back in the ongoing window.

 

Everton boss Sean Dyche is looking to strengthen his squad and believes that Dumfries will be a good addition to his squad.

 

 

However, according to Italian outlet Calciomercato.com, the idea of joining Everton in the summer has not intrigued the Dutch international due to Dyche’s side not being involved in European competition next season.

 

Dumfries has two more years left in his contract and there are other clubs who have their eyes on the Dutch wing-back.

 

 

Now it remains to be seen whether Everton will be able to convince Dumfries to join them in the summer.
